Israel’s National Security Imperatives

Israel operates within a hostile neighborhood. Its security depends on vigilance. The nation constantly assesses threats. Iran’s nuclear program and regional proxies are primary concerns.

Military readiness is paramount. Israel maintains a robust defense posture. It invests heavily in intelligence gathering. This ensures a proactive approach to emerging threats.

Close coordination with the United States is vital. This partnership provides critical support. It enhances Israel’s defensive capabilities. It also strengthens its diplomatic standing.

Iran’s Regional Influence and Defense Strategy

Iran asserts its role as a regional power. Its foreign policy prioritizes national sovereignty. It often resists perceived external pressures. This stance shapes its interactions with the US and Israel.

The nation continues to develop its strategic capabilities. This includes ballistic missile programs. It also involves support for regional proxies. These actions contribute to the heightened tensions.

Consequently, Iran seeks to expand its influence. It aims to secure its borders. It also strives to protect its geopolitical interests. This forms the core of its defense strategy.

Economic Repercussions of Geopolitical Strife

Geopolitical tensions rarely remain isolated. They often spill into the global economy. The US Israel Iran situation is no exception. Energy markets are particularly sensitive to regional instability.

Oil prices can fluctuate dramatically. This impacts consumers and industries globally. Shipping routes in vital waterways also face risks. Trade flows can be disrupted significantly.

Investor confidence can erode. Uncertainty deters foreign investment. This affects economic growth in the region and beyond. Financial markets react swiftly to perceived threats.
